See scans for signature quality and photo condition. BIO: Samuel Joseph Dente (Blackie) was born in Harrison, NJ and died in 2002 in Montclair, NJ. He played major league baseball from 1947 to 1955 as infielder for the Boston Red Sox, St. Louis Browns, Washington Senators, Chicago White Sox, and the Cleveland Indians, and appeared in the 1954 World Series. Dente was sent by the Red Sox to the Washington Senators in the same transaction that brought Ellis Kinder to Boston. After that, the slogan "We'll win plenty with Dente" circulated through the stands at Griffith Stadium early in the 1950 season when the club led the American League, but a short time after that the rhyme became more popular than the player.
